WebBuilt by: Bath Iron Works (Bath, ME) Destroyer Class: Fletcher: Laid down: March 3, 1941: Designed Shaft HP: 60,000 WebTake out all objects. Reshape the modeling clay to look like a bowl or boat. Now place the clay in the bowl. It should float. In fact, if you place the marbles gently in the center of the clay, they should float, too. If it does not float reshape your clay until you have a structure that will float and hold 1 — 3 marbles afloat.

WebSep 20, 2007 · Each student uses a small quantity of modeling clay to make a boat that will float in a tub of water. The object is to build a boat that will hold as much weight as possible without sinking. Written to introduce pupils to buoyancy, this activity has collaborative groups work to design a floatable clay boat.
